#1638d4 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1638d4 is composed of 8.6% red, 22% green and 83.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 89.6% cyan, 73.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 16.9% black. It has a hue angle of 229.3 degrees, a saturation of 81.2% and a lightness of 45.9%. #1638d4 color hex could be obtained by blending #2c70ff with #0000a9. Closest websafe color is: #0033cc.

#1638d4 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1638d4 has RGB values of R:22, G:56, B:212 and CMYK values of C:0.9, M:0.74, Y:0, K:0.17. Its decimal value is 1456340.

Shades and Tints of #1638d4
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020411 is the darkest color, while #fefeff is the lightest one.

Tones of #1638d4
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#70727a is the less saturated color, while #042ce6 is the most saturated one.
